Bolton: Trump withdrawal without Hormuz reopening would benefit Iran

Former NSA Bolton argues that if Trump administration exits Iran engagement without securing reopening of the Strait of Hormuz, it would constitute a strategic victory for Tehran and signal to Iranian leadership they can maintain chokepoints on global trade at will. The statement reflects debate over conditions for any Trump Iran policy reset and concerns about freedom of navigation in critical maritime lanes.

Trump reportedly considers Iran withdrawal amid Hormuz closure, tanker attack

Reports indicate President Trump is considering a U.S. withdrawal from Iranian operations while the Strait of Hormuz remains closed, coinciding with a new attack on a tanker vessel. The strategic implications of decoupling from Iran operations while maintaining the waterway closure remain unclear, as does the connection between Trump's reported deliberations and the concurrent maritime incident.
